Jacqueline Kennedy Onassis Bag

Luxury handbags are coveted by many fashion enthusiasts and collectors worldwide. Among the most sought-after brands is Gucci, which has been producing high-end accessories for almost 100 years. Over time, a few rare editions of Gucci handbags have emerged as especially valuable and desirable among collectors.

One such edition is the Gucci Jackie O bag, named after former First Lady Jacqueline Kennedy Onassis who was an avid fan of the brand. The bag features a unique shoulder strap made from bamboo and comes in various materials such as leather or canvas. Another popular edition is the Gucci Flora bag that showcases intricate floral designs on its exterior.

The Bamboo Bag by Gucci is another iconic piece that has stood the test of time since its introduction in 1947. Made from natural bamboo material combined with leather or fabric, this bag epitomizes elegance and style while maintaining practicality and durability.

Gucci’s collaboration with artist Richard Ginori resulted in one-of-a-kind bags called “Gucci-Richard Ginori.” These limited-edition pieces feature bold prints inspired by traditional Italian artwork and pottery designs.

The latest addition to Gucci’s rare collection is the Dionysus Bag designed by current Creative Director Alessandro Michele. This luxurious piece features a tiger head closure surrounded by Swarovski crystals, making it highly coveted among fashion enthusiasts all over the world.
